Hi all,

want to check if it is ok to use wall mount chimney hood for HDB ?

Thanks,

Chee Yong

Hi, try to go for the slimline model trust me, chimey ones are good to look at but take up lots of space besides hdb don't have a very high ceiling. u can put better use of the space save for storage. For me I will be discarding my chimey hood because I don't use it often and if don't do a lot of frying better off jus wipe down after cooking.

Yup, couldn't agree more with 2ndtime. :)

Chimney hood nice to see, but not practical to use. The chimney part is nothing but a hollow shell.

Personally, i rather have the storage space.

For hoods, ony the part with the filter is important. The rest, chimney and stuff only looks good.

I would never get a hood that leads the fumes towards the ceiling. Later its all brown there.

It would be better if the fumes could be diverted towards the outside, but HDB doesn't allow that.
